Pravo, Ohio

Unincorporated community in Ohio, U.S.

Pravo is an unincorporated community in Jefferson County, in the U.S. state of Ohio.[1]

History

A post office called Pravo was established in 1892, and remained in operation until 1907.[2] Besides the post office, Provo had a Methodist Episcopal church.[3]
